Job Description **MEMBERS ONLY**SIGN UP NOW*** is a well-respected and highly successful law firm specializing in business litigation. With a focus on securities, intellectual property, and employment litigation, the firm has built a strong reputation for delivering exceptional legal services to its clients. As a result of continued growth, the firm is seeking an experienced Business Litigation Associate to join their team.
The ideal candidate for this role will have a minimum of 4-7 years of experience in business litigation, specifically in the areas of securities, intellectual property, and employment. They must also be a member of the California Bar. The firm values candidates with excellent academic credentials and a strong background in business litigation.

Key Responsibilities: - Handle all aspects of business litigation cases, including research, drafting pleadings, motions, and discovery - Represent clients in court, depositions, and arbitrations - Conduct legal research and stay updated on relevant laws and regulations - Collaborate with other attorneys and staff to formulate case strategies and provide legal advice to clients
Qualifications: - Minimum of 4-7 years of experience in business litigation, preferably in the areas of securities, intellectual property, and employment - Member of the California Bar - Excellent academic credentials - Strong research, writing, and analytical skills - Ability to work independently and as part of a team - Proven track record of success in business litigation cases
Compensation and Benefits: - Competitive salary range of $200,000 - $280,000 annually - Comprehensive benefits package, including health insurance, retirement plans, and paid time off - Opportunity for growth and advancement within the firm
